10 The fields are destroyed;(A)
the land grieves;
indeed, the grain is destroyed;
the new wine is dried up;(B)
and the olive oil fails.(C)
11 Be ashamed, you farmers,(D)
wail, you vinedressers,[a]
over the wheat and the barley,
because the harvest of the field has perished.(E)
12 The grapevine is dried up,(F)
and the fig tree is withered;
the pomegranate,(G) the date palm,(H) and the apple(I)
all the trees of the orchard—have withered.
Indeed, human joy has dried up.(J)
